At 81, Gladys Knight Finally Tells the Truth About Michael Jackson

At 81, Gladys Knight Finally Tells the Truth About Michael Jackson, and fans can’t stop talking about it. In a rare and emotional conversation, the legendary “Empress of Soul” opened up about her decades-long relationship with the King of Pop — a connection that began long before his superstardom. Knight recalled seeing young Michael perform with the Jackson 5 for the first time and instantly knowing he was destined for greatness. “He had that light,” she said, her voice filled with both pride and sadness. “But I also saw the weight that light would bring him.”

Knight didn’t shy away from addressing the darker side of fame. She reflected on how success isolated Michael, explaining that the industry that built him also broke him. “We were kids in this business, and they wanted perfection. But no one survives that kind of pressure forever,” she admitted. Her words painted a picture of compassion and hard-earned wisdom — not judgment, but understanding of what it means to rise too fast and too high.

When asked what she’d say to him if he were still here, Knight paused. “I’d tell him I was proud. That he gave the world more than it ever gave him,” she said softly. Fans have since flooded social media, calling her words “the closure they didn’t know they needed.” For many, Gladys Knight’s truth wasn’t just about Michael Jackson — it was a reflection on fame, humanity, and the cost of being extraordinary.
